The Context

Security firms currently manage hundreds of high-stakes contracts using generic, fragmented tools. This creates massive compliance risks and blocks their access to lender financing. We partnered with Loyva to design the industry’s first purpose-built ecosystem—a single source of truth that turns document chaos into a scalable business asset.

Why generic solutions fall short for security firms.

The market is vast, but it is currently served by generalist tools. While competitors focus on the act of signing, Loyva fills the gap by managing the high-stakes compliance lifecycle that happens after the signature.

The Challenge

Security firms are drowning in document silos and generic tools.

The Impact is companies waste valuable time navigating between systems, resulting in lost audit trails and significant regulatory risks. The Gap is a lack of a unified, compliant repository that handles the entire contract lifecycle in one place.

UX Research

Designing for the person carrying the risk.

To build a solution that actually sticks, We focused on "Mike"—a mid-size security owner represents our primary user archetype. Our research revealed that the transition from paper to digital isn't just a technical challenge; it’s an emotional one rooted in compliance anxiety and operational overwhelm.

Mapping the internal and external struggle.

Understanding Mike's mindset was critical. While he thinks about ROI and insurance savings, he feels overwhelmed by 800+ paper contracts and the fear of lender rejection.

Interview Highlight: Mike’s biggest pain point is the 10+ hours spent weekly on manual filing. The solution had to be simple enough to adopt without disrupting daily operations, or he would never use it.

Information Architecture

Blueprinting a compliant, "zero-friction" ecosystem.

Before moving to high-fidelity, We mapped out the contract lifecycle to ensure Mike could move from "Upload" to "Vaulted" in under three clicks. The goal was to eliminate the 10-hour weekly filing burden identified in our research.
